What are the responsibilities and job description for the Senior Construction Project Manager - Regional position at Austin Industrial, Inc.?
This position is responsible for overall supervision and coordination on small to medium size projects, under the supervision of an Operations Manager. Responsible for the successful completion of the project including meeting expectations for safety, quality, schedule, and performing at or below the project budget. This position requires leadership capability including the ability to create a good working relationship with customers, owners, engineers, vendors, and subcontractors. Responsible for executing the project, in compliance with the prime contract and Austin policies and procedures.
